The hexadecimal color code #777814 corresponds to the code RGB( 119, 120, 20 ). It's a shade of Yellow. This color is a combination of red (at 0,47 level), green (at 0,47 level) and blue (at 0,08 level). Its brightness is 27% and its saturation is 71%. It is composed of red at 45%, green at 46% and blue at 7%.
